The Foundations of Credible Casino Ratings
At the core, a robust casino rating system should be rooted in transparency, verifiable data, and industry best practices. This involves a multi-faceted evaluation that considers technical security, game integrity, user experience, customer support, and responsible gambling policies. Industry leaders employ a combination of player feedback, independent audits, and regulatory compliance reports to formulate their assessments.
For instance, independent testing agencies such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s provide certification that underscores a platform’s fairness and security. Meanwhile, regulatory compliance—such as licences from the UK Gambling Commission—serves as an attestment to a casino’s adherence to stringent standards. These pillars ensure that ratings reflect real-world fairness and safety, rather than superficial features.
The Role of Industry Data and Player Feedback
While authoritative certifications form a backbone, real user experiences tell an equally vital story. Aggregated player reviews, payout speed, and clarity of terms often influence a casino’s reputation more than any advertised bonus. Therefore, comprehensive rating portals compile and analyse this data to present an impartial picture.
Advanced rating sites leverage data analytics to identify underlying patterns: for example, a spike in withdrawal delays might flag operational issues. Combining quantitative metrics with qualitative insights fosters a nuanced understanding, vital for discerning the true quality of a platform.
